Prepare for a proper polarizing potion with Vanilla Woods. This one's either a luscious, smoky vanilla dream or a 'cigarette ash and plastic' nightmare depending on your skin. Definitely don't blind buy unless you fancy a gamble.
This one's a proper gourmand, a sweet, fluffy vanilla and caramel delight that's sparked a fair bit of debate. Some reckon it's a smooth, sophisticated dream, while others are clocking a weird, plasticky note. Best have a sniff yourself before committing to a full bottle.

Season and Occasion Fit
Seasons
A cold-weather scent - best worn in autumn and winter.
Occasions
While some find it inoffensive, the sweet, often intense gourmand nature and smoky undertone of Vanilla Woods make it less ideal for office wear. It truly shines for dates and casual outings, particularly in colder weather, where its warmth and depth can be appreciated. Formal events are a maybe, depending on the wearer’s chemistry and the specific 'vibe' of the perfume on them.
Seasons
A cold-weather scent - best worn in autumn and winter.
Occasions
Its potent vanilla and caramel profile, alongside reports of decent projection and longevity, makes it a bit much for the office or formal events. However, these same qualities make it perfect for casual outings or a romantic date night where you want to leave a delicious impression.
